使用select table_name.*
的优点是可以快速选择表中的所有列,方便查询和使用数据。这种写法适用于需要获取表中所有列的情况,可以简化查询语句的编写,提高开发效率。
然而,使用select table_name.*
也存在一些缺点。首先,当表结构发生变化时,例如添加或删除列,使用select table_name.*
的查询语句可能会返回不需要的列或缺少新添加的列。这会导致数据处理错误或缺失。其次,如果表中存在大量的列,使用select table_name.*
可能会导致查询结果的数据量过大,增加网络传输和处理的负担,影响查询性能。此外,如果查询结果中只需要部分列,使用select table_name.*
会浪费网络带宽和系统资源。
因此,在实际开发中,建议根据具体需求选择需要的列,而不是使用select table_name.*
。这样可以确保查询结果准确、高效,并且避免不必要的数据传输和资源浪费。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云